US sends congressional team to Mid-East
July 21, 2006
The US Congress will send a delegation to the Middle East to assess conditions there following the ongoing hostilities between Israel and Hezbollah.

"Terrorists are in a fight against peace and freedom all over the world," , House Speaker Dennis Hastert said in his announcement of the trip.

"The delegation will send a clear message that we stand with our ally Israel in the fight against terrorism, and that we stand with all people and governments in the region that oppose terrorism as a means to achieve political goals," he said.

Mr Hastert said the group would be led by Peter Hoekstra, chairman of the House Select Committee on Intelligence.

He will leave this weekend, along with the top Democrat on the Intelligence committee Jane Harman, and Representatives Rick Renzi and Darrell Issa, both Republicans, who serve on the same panel.

The group is to meet US, Israeli and Palestinian officials about the violence and how best to end it.

"The delegation is the first and only congressional delegation that has been cleared to go to Israel since the current conflict began," Mr Hastert said.

"The Intelligence Committee had been planning this trip to Israel and the Middle East for several weeks, but in light of the outbreak of violence, the speaker requested the delegation immediately take on the added mission of showing support," Mr Hastert said.
